Mazel tov to Ellen DeGeneres and Portia DeRossi, who got hitched over the weekend, and thanks to the recent California Supreme Court ruling that same sex couples have the right to wed, it was all nice and legal to boot. The private ceremony took place at their home in Los Angeles with a small guest list, but with cameras present we can be sure that some highlights will feature soon, most likely on Ellen’s multi-award winning daytime talk show. Both the engagement and the upcoming nuptials have been discussed on Ellen’s show, which is a refreshing change from all those years ago when the coming out of her character on her sitcom (Ellen) allegedly led to the show being cancelled by network ABC not long afterwards.
